Abstract

The number of high power users operating in the subsystem will rise in line with economic expansion, which will result in overloading conditions on the inter bus transformers (IBT). To overcome the overload condition of 500 kV/150 kV (IBT) in the X area due to load forecasting, 2×400 MW power plant is planned to be moved from 500 kV bus into 150 kV bus. This research aims to analyze the power flow and short circuit study before and after the migration is implemented. The method used in this research is a simulation using ETAP software. From the results of the power flow study, it can be concluded that the migration of 2 units of power plant can reduce the load on IBT 1 and IBT 2 both under normal conditions and during contingency in one of IBTs. In addition, it also increases the bus voltage profile, reducing losses in the 150 kV sub-system area. From the results of the short circuit study, migrating 2×400 MW power plant units, is safe in terms of equipment durability.
